Features

  • Durable heavy denier fabric and 3 layer thermal ply waterproof, windproof, breathable fabric trim, dura-grip palm, fingers, thumb and wrap caps with spandura panel.
  • Naturaloft® insulation package: 600 fill power of 70% goose down 30% waterfowl feathers on back of hand, Megaloft® on palm side, Hydrowick lining with thermo-plush in the cuff, Gore-Tex® Guaranteed to Keep You Dry®, waterproof, windproof, breathable insert.
  • Gauntlet cinch closure
  • pre-curved construction
  • wrap caps

Glossary

Naturaloft®A goose down insulating concept. Our Naturaloft® gloves are insulated with 600 fill power goose down on the back of the hand. The down is isolated in small chambers so there is no fill migration. This ensures even distribution of the goose down and the ultimate in insulation performance. The palms of each glove are made from Megaloft® insulation, a lofty and soft insulation that will not compress on the palm, it provides warmth and ensures good manual dexterity. Naturaloft® mitts are made of 600 fill power goose down; the down in mitts is also encapsulated to prevent against migration with down in both the back of the hand and palm. These mitts are an essential skiing product for those that need the warmest mitts available.
GORE-TEX®Technology keeps water out of our gloves, while allowing moisture from the inside (perspiration) to easily escape. The result is a glove that’s highly breathable and totally waterproof. The microporous structure of the GORE-TEX® membrane is what makes GORE-TEX® products completely waterproof. Each microscopic pore is about 20,000 times smaller than a drop of water, which means no external moisture — from rain to snow — can penetrate the membrane. The pores in the GORE-TEX® membrane are 700 times bigger than a water vapor molecule, so perspiration can easily evaporate through and you can stay dry from the inside out. Gore-Tex® Guaranteed to Keep You Dry®.
